## Releases

Stampede is the load-testing harness for the Quillmark checkout flow. Cut releases from `stable` only, after a green full-scenario run. Version tags gate which scenario packs production runners will accept. Each release tarball must be signed before the runners will load it, and the signing step uses the key below.

signing key of baduf-taweg = bky6_Zf7bem

Subject: Key rotation — Shrinkray CLI plugin API

Plugin authors: we're rotating credentials for the Shrinkray batch-resize CLI on the 15th. Old keys stop working at cutover; there is no grace period. Update your plugin manifests before then and rerun the conformance suite. Rate limits are unchanged. Report breakage through the plugin portal. The replacement key for the plugin integration endpoint is below.

gateway credential: kto3_qfe

Quick note on sorting in the Marlowe report builder: we promise stable sort across all grouped columns, because clients at Bexley Analytics noticed rows jumping around between exports. Under the hood we use a merge-based comparator with a tie-break on ingestion order, so please don't swap in anything 'faster' without checking stability. The comparator's behavior is heavily influenced by a handful of thresholds — batch size, spill limits, and so on — which are easy to get wrong. They're defined here.

tuning table, yajog-yahof:
BUDGETS = {
    "lamvan": 303,
    "wenox": 460,
    "fenvan": 525,
}

Quick one for the new folks: the Pellworth app sometimes hands out a refresh token that's already rotated, so users get bounced to login. If it flares up, check the token table for rows with mismatched rotation epochs. You can connect to the auth database with the string below.

replica DSN, kajep-yahag: mssql://praok_svc:iF@db-8d68.plorvaio.local:5432/eliion